PETALING JAYA: Malaysia Airlines denied that it did not give any prior notice to the next of kin before authorities declared that everyone on board MH370 was “presumed dead”.
“Prior to the scheduled announcement by Civil Aviation Department, all next of kin were notified via telephone calls. And, in certain instances, by text messages when the calls went unanswered,” MAS said in a statement.
